Twitch artist \u201cNysttren\u201d went on a heated tirade regarding the website on September 26, after a 4Chan user had requested a drawing of Demon Slayer\u2019s \u201cNezuko Kamado\u201d in a bunny outfit. However, the user didn\u2019t seem to be very appreciative of Nysttren\u2019s product, replying with a passive-aggressive gif in with an equally passive-aggressive filename that admitted they had requested the art as a \u201cjoke.\u201d \u201cFor some reason, I always seem to deliver for the most ungrateful pieces of sh*t on this website, every time,\u201d Nysttren said of the response. \u201cThat\u2019s why I stopped fulfilling requests on these types of threads, because I would always deliver for people that don\u2019t deserve it, right?\u201d While her rant was certainly warranted, it looks like her visit to 4Chan may not have been in her best interests, as the streamer was hit with a one-day ban from Twitch after showing the site during her broadcast. According to an email shown in her Tweet on the subject, Nysttren was banned for \u201cbrowsing websites or apps featuring content that violates Twitch\u2019s community guidelines,\u201d prompting the streamer to write, \u201cOmg I\u2019m famous now.\u201d Nysttren wouldn\u2019t be the first Twitch streamer to receive a ban for violating the site\u2019s community guidelines as of late, either: \u201cpin-up\u201d artist \u201cSaruei\u201d was similarly hit with a ban after drawing images of \u201cFate\/Grand Order\u201d characters earlier this month, later lashing out at the site due to creating similar kinds of content for a year before being punished.
